site stats

Mock useroutematch

Web15 okt. 2024 · A way to mock the push function of useHistory: import reactRouterDom from 'react-router-dom'; jest.mock ('react-router-dom'); const pushMock = jest.fn (); … WebLearn once, Route Anywhere

React Router v6 useRouteMatch equivalent - Stack Overflow

Web5 mei 2024 · How to mock useRouter parameters for react-hooks-testing-library? const urlHook = () => { const router = useRouter (); const read = () => { return validate … WebuseRouteMatch() should be called inside a component and returns an object with a url and a path property. This object is sometimes referred to as the match object: The path … plasenta kaç kilo olur https://icechipsdiamonddust.com

Umi 4 发布啦 🎈 - 知乎 - 知乎专栏

Web28 okt. 2024 · Implementation. Firstly, we need to mock the modules of all the components the Router routes to. The modules that contain the components need to be imported and then mocked using the jest.mock … WebFind the best open-source package for your project with Snyk Open Source Advisor. Explore over 1 million open source packages. Web4 jul. 2024 · useParams. This is the easiest hook from react-router to understand. Whenever you call this hook you will get an object that stores all the parameters as attributes. You just need this line of code and you can have access to your params. const params = useParams(); you can play around in my CodeSandBox. plasa telkom sidoarjo kota

react-router.useRouteMatch JavaScript and Node.js code …

Category:Testing the React Router useNavigate Hook with react-testing …

Tags:Mock useroutematch

Mock useroutematch

React Router 與 Hook 的邂逅 tom 的技術文章

WebuseRouteMatch在对于一些,不是路由级别的组件。但是组件自身的显隐却和当前路径相关的组件时,非常有用。 比如,你在做一个后台管理系统时,网页的Header只会在登录页显示,登录完成后不需要显示,这种场景下就可以用到useRouteMatch。 <= V5.0 Web24 sep. 2024 · useRouteMatch. The useRouteMatch hook is useful any time you are using a just so you can get access to its match data, including all of the times you …

Mock useroutematch

Did you know?

Web8 nov. 2024 · 前言. Hooks大行天下之后,关于如何使用 Hooks,如何替代 Redux 实现状态管理等文章甚嚣尘上,甚至介绍Redux-Hooks实现的文章也有很多,唯独少了全家桶三件套之一的React-Router的Hooks方法,让人有点惊异。. 其实React-Router4.0版本已经是一两年前的产品了,作者发布4.X ... Web13 feb. 2024 · To do so, make a new directory called ‘__mocks__’ next to the component you want to mock. Remove the factory argument from your call to jest.mock, and jest will automatically locate manual mocks and use them in your test. This is useful if you always want your mock to behave the same way. Recently, however, I needed to create a …

Web15 okt. 2024 · For anyone who finds this thread because they are attempting to implement 'useRouteMatch' to nest routes in child components, the short answer is that React … Web3 okt. 2024 · Makes sense. In order for our hook to work, we need to surround any of its usages with the right context provider, which in this case only BrowserRouter from react-router-dom can provide.. To fix this test we have two options: mocking react-router-dom; wrapping the hook with BrowserRouter; To start with, here's the version of the test with a …

Web22 jan. 2024 · useRouteMatch. 接下來介紹最後一個 Hook 是 useRouteMatch, 這個 Hook 讓我們可以輕易 access match 這個屬性, 以往都要透過 Route Component 方式取得 match 屬性, useRouteMatch 跟 Route Component 的行為基本上是一樣的, 且寫起來更優雅。 以下為取得 match object 的方式: WebWe'll first import matchPath, this is the mechanism that react-router uses to match paths via the Route component. The first argument is the path to attempt to parse, it will be what you would see in the URL like /profile/1. Then we need to pass in our configuration. The keys for the configuration are the same that you would supply to the Route ...

WebuseRouter If you use React Router you might have noticed they recently added a number of useful hooks, specifically useParams, useLocation, useHistory, and use …

Web23 apr. 2024 · useRouteMatch 挂钩尝试以与 相同的方式匹配当前 URL 。 在无需实际呈现 的情况下访问匹配数据最有用。 bank austria amundi fondsWebOr, when using the useTranslation hook instead of withTranslation, mock it like: jest . mock ( 'react-i18next' , () => ({ // this mock makes sure any components using the translate hook can use it without a warning being shown bank austria app ipadWebBest JavaScript code snippets using react-router.useRouteMatch (Showing top 15 results out of 315) react-router ( npm) useRouteMatch. plaskan maiden ritualWeb有可能是包了 router 在 component外,然後又 mock 了 react-router-dom ... 測試 useHistory, useRouteMatch. Invariant Violation: You should not use or withRouter() outside a Mock 某個 import 的 module. bank austria anmeldung online bankingWeb13 jan. 2024 · Approach 1: Using the and JSX components. This is the primary way of rendering something using React Router and the approach that would be seen used in many places. Hence, I won't dwell much on the syntax of this but drop the example which will be used in the rest of this article. bank austria b7Web11 feb. 2024 · You can also use useRouteMatch to access a match without rendering a Route. This is done by passing it the location argument. For example, consider that you … bank austria app aktualisierenWebIn my case it was from the module.exports.. Instead of writing. module.exports = {sum: sum}; Write. module.exports = sum; Note: sum is a function that adds 2 numbers plasma hoito